1-Pervasiveness : ( manufacture, retailer, design, university, health services ). Most organizations function as part of a larger supply chain. The Definitions of supply chain : Networks of manufactures and service provides that works together to move goods from the raw material stage through to the end user linked through physical, information and monetary flows. 2- profitability and survival : manage their operations and supply chains to prosper and indeed survive !! SUPPLY CHAIN MANAGEMENT


Active management and activities and relationships to maximize customers value and achieves a sustainable competitive advantage. Materials flows : links between supplier , disturber , and final customer. Supply chain issues : ( length of the chain, complexity, stability, physical, informational, and monetary flows ) . Supply chain operations Reference ( SCOR ) Model : Planning activities Sourcing activities make or production activities delivery activities return activities
